Coily Hair: Everything about this hair type

Coily hair is a subtype of the kinky hair family. It is the most fragile of all hair types because it lacks the needed cuticle layers to prevent dryness. If you have coily hair, you may face problems such as dryness, tangles, shrinkage, and also breakage. Choosing a suitable styling product can moisture your hair and bring it back to life. Tips For High Porosity Curly Hair

What is porosity? It refers to how efficiently your hair can take in and hold moisture. High porosity curly hair can easily absorb lots of water. But, this type of hair can easily lose the moisture it gains too. High porosity hair is more prone to damage from harsh chemicals, dyeing, high heat, and harsh shampoos.
